Have always loved ebay - but just got scammed this week for a handbag bought & paid. The item disappeared from ebay so raised an investigation and Ebay said that the seller's id had been hijacked and a scammer had sold multiple items relying on the high feedback rating of the genuine seller. good job paypal offer £150 insurance on all purchases paid through them

So just be aware guys :eek: Try and check feedback thoroughly and even contact the seller before buying
